Rebecca Downes

Rebecca Downes is a British blues rock singer, guitarist, and songwriter from Wolverhampton. She began performing live at age 13 and started writing her own material as a teenager. Teaming up in 2011 with co-songwriter Steve Birkett, she developed a signature sound rooted in blues but exploring various musical directions. Rebecca has released multiple albums on her independent label Mad Hat Records, including *Back To The Start* (2013), *More Sinner Than Saint* (2019), and her most recent *A Storm Is Coming* (2025) featuring singles like "These Days" and "Falling Into You." She’s known for her strong vocals and compelling songwriting, earning accolades such as Female Vocalist of the Year and Emerging Artist of the Year at the 2016 British Blues Awards.

In addition to her work as a performer, Rebecca is an experienced vocal coach and lecturer based in Birmingham. Her live shows feature a tight five-piece band, with a mix of original songs and blues classics. She has supported acts like King King, Dr Feelgood, and Paul Carrack, building a dedicated following through a strategic balance of festival appearances and club gigs. Rebecca continues to push blues rock forward with passion and integrity, while nurturing the next generation of singers through teaching and mentorship.
